In 2023, the median pay for an employee at Meta was just over $379,000, higher than the average tech job and in line with what Google and Amazon pay their employees. With a workforce of around 67,000 employees, Meta has a wide range in pay scales.
When comparing roles within Meta, software engineers and researchers tend to earn more in base pay than product designers and user experience professionals. However, in the bigger picture of Big Tech, a median salary of $379,000 is not uncommon. Industry giants like Google and Amazon also have positions that pay well above $300,000.
While CEO Mark Zuckerberg’s total compensation in 2023 was $24.4 million, most of it coming from security and logistical expenses. However, Zuckerberg only took a $1 salary last year with the majority of his wealth tied to stock options. Despite the high compensation, Meta has been on an efficiency drive since 2022 which has led to frequent layoffs. The company reported strong earnings but also plans to increase investments in AI which has made investors cautious about the company’s future.
